Department of Sociology records

 Record Group — Multiple Containers
Identifier: RG-04-230
Abstract

The Department of Sociology at Johns Hopkins was founded in 1959 by American sociologist James Coleman. The department concentrates on two broad areas at the graduate and undergraduate levels: global social change and social inequality. This collection contains records of the Department of Sociology from circa 1960 to 1990, and an archived website from 2015 - Ongoing. The records may include faculty and student records.

Dates: circa 1960s-1990; 2015 - Ongoing

Maryland Mutual Insurance Company records

 Collection
Identifier: MS-0115
Abstract

The Maryland Mutual Insurance Company was located in Baltimore and dealt in marine insurance. The company was chartered in 1858 and operated from about 1860 until 1877. This collection includes records of both the Maryland Mutual Insurance Company and the Baltimore Marine Insurance Company, and consists of administrative and financial records. Materials in the collection span 1858 to 1879.

Dates: 1858-1879
